“What are your fitness goals, and why are they important to you?” It’s a simple question, yet its impact is profound. In the sea of generic workout plans, this inquiry signals a departure from the one-size-fits-all approach. Suddenly, the client is not just a face on the screen but an individual with a unique journey, aspirations, and challenges.
As the conversation unfolds, the online fitness coach becomes a guide, navigating the client through the maze of possibilities. “How does your daily routine look, and where do you see fitness fitting into it?” The question transcends the physical aspect of exercise, delving into the intricacies of lifestyle and habit. It’s an exploration that goes beyond sets and reps, aiming to integrate fitness seamlessly into the client’s life.

The beauty of sales mastery lies in its adaptability. It’s not a rigid script but a dynamic conversation. “How do you prefer to receive feedback and support?” The question acknowledges that coaching is not a one-size-fits-all experience. Some clients thrive on encouragement, while others value constructive criticism. Tailoring the coaching style to individual preferences is not just a strategy; it’s a demonstration of empathy and understanding.
As the online fitness coach refines their questioning skills, they enter the realm of anticipatory coaching. “What changes do you foresee in your lifestyle, and how can we adjust your fitness plan accordingly?” The question is a proactive step towards ensuring that the fitness journey remains aligned with the evolving needs of the client. It’s a commitment to continuous adaptation, an acknowledgment that transformation is not a linear path but a dynamic process.
In the narrative of sales mastery, objections are not roadblocks but stepping stones. “What concerns or doubts do you have, and how can we address them together?” The question invites transparency and opens the door for constructive dialogue. Objections are not hurdles to overcome; they are opportunities to refine the approach and tailor the coaching experience to the client’s needs.
